2nd Chance Candle Co. is a Shopify-based ecommerce store selling handmade scented candles. Its brand story centers on honoring co-founder Martha A. Garcia, with a charitable narrative built around support for cancer and stroke survivors. The site sells finished candles, memorial candles, custom mini jar candles, and candle tools and accessories.
Its main selling point is not low prices or a large SKU catalog, but “candles with a purpose.” The 2nd Chance Candle is positioned around survivor support, while The 2nd Chance Project Candle states that 100% of profits are donated to its nonprofit organization. Products emphasize hand-pouring, non-toxic and additive-free formulas, Clean Scent fragrance oils, no carcinogens, and being 100% phthalate-free. Some products use coconut soy wax, natural wooden wicks, or personalized name labels. Custom orders include 2oz and 3.5oz mini jar candles, with a minimum order of one dozen, and options for label design, themed text/images, and fragrance selection.
Pricing on the site is transparent. Regular monthly scented candles are mostly $22, 7oz/8oz gift candles are around $35, and the charity project candle is $65. Custom dozen sets are priced at $65 or $85. Shipping is calculated at checkout. For regular orders, the site only states that it will make every effort to process and ship orders promptly; custom orders are estimated to take about 3 weeks.
Its strengths are a clear brand story, strong charitable positioning, well-defined gifting and memorial use cases, and relatively complete descriptions of its clean formulation. For consumers who value emotional expression and healthier home fragrance, it has meaningful differentiation. The drawbacks are that the captured content does not show payment methods, shipping countries, return/exchange details, or customer service information. Multiple sold-out items also suggest that inventory stability may be average. If buying for an urgent event, the 3-week custom production timeline needs to be planned for in advance.
It is better suited to individual gift buyers, supporters of cancer or stroke survivors, users looking for memorial gifts, and purchasers of small-event or corporate custom favors. It is not a platform aimed at third-party sellers. Access from mainland China cannot be determined from the available page content and is therefore marked as unknown. Cross-border shipping and payment availability should also be confirmed based on what is shown at checkout.
